The Physical Risks of Quitting Cold Turkey

To begin with, quitting cold turkey refers to the abrupt cessation of substance use without medical or therapeutic support. This method can lead to severe withdrawal symptoms, which vary depending on the substance and the individual’s level of dependence. For instance, alcohol withdrawal can cause symptoms ranging from mild anxiety and tremors to severe complications such as seizures and delirium tremens. Similarly, opioid withdrawal can result in intense discomfort, including muscle aches, fever, and nausea, which, although not typically life-threatening, can be excruciating.

In addition, sudden cessation of certain substances can shock the body, leading to potentially fatal outcomes. For example, benzodiazepines, commonly prescribed for anxiety and insomnia, can cause life-threatening seizures if abruptly discontinued. The Mental and Emotional Challenges

Moreover, the mental and emotional toll of quitting cold turkey can be equally daunting. Addiction often coexists with mental health disorders such as depression and anxiety. Abruptly stopping substance use can exacerbate these conditions, leading to severe emotional distress. Without proper support, individuals may experience overwhelming cravings and a heightened risk of relapse.

Transitioning to a sober life requires more than just the physical act of stopping substance use; it involves addressing the underlying psychological factors that contribute to addiction.
